Humble Yourself
Humble yourself before others as you would before the Lord.
Be not prideful or boastful. Earths treasures do not hoard.
Judge not the poor or look down upon their woes for they are
all Gods children and he will surely know.
Misuse not the blessings given you in love.
Remember they are poured from heaven up above.
If Jesus were to ask you to give up all you had, would you
from joy of heart go from riches unto rags?
The gates of hell are open and await the souls of man
so be wary your salvation. Before God one day you'll stand.
